Where does this employer donation data come from?

All data is sourced from FEC public filings. Federal law requires committees to report the employer of individuals who contribute more than $200 in an election cycle. EQUITY PRIME MORTGAGE (EPM) as an organization does not necessarily endorse these contributions.
